(f) Commercial building permit valuation. The building permit fee charged to build a new building, to add on to an existing building, or to remodel or alter an existing commercial building shall be based on the declared valuation of the proposed work; this includes all miscellaneous building permits, accessory buildings, detached garages and in-ground swimming pools. The building official may require the applicant to verify the declared value. The commercial building permit fee shall be calculated based upon figured from table I-A as provided in this section. | ||
